Responsibilities
- Develop, maintain, and update LLNL emergency plans, procedures, checklists, and Emergency Action Levels (EALs) for all-hazards incidents in alignment with DOE Order 151.1.
- Integrate technical analyses, including EPHA facility data, into emergency planning documents to ensure accurate hazard assessment and response strategies.
- Develop and refine Emergency Operations Center (EOC) processes for information management, decision support, and coordination with LLNL leadership and external agencies.
- Coordinate with Laboratory programs, facility management, and support organizations to ensure emergency plans are accurate, integrated, and executable.
- Ensure emergency planning activities comply with DOE/NNSA requirements, national emergency management standards, and applicable state and local partner expectations.
- Support the design and execution of emergency exercises and evaluate lessons learned from exercises, real incidents, and DOE events to strengthen response capabilities.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
- Serve as a technical representative on formal and ad hoc teams addressing complex technical issues related to hazardous facility analysis; develop defensible, data-driven solutions.
- Perform computer modeling of hazardous material releases and consequence analyses to inform and scale emergency response capabilities.
- Develop technical reports and procedures and maintain Emergency Planning Hazards Assessments (EPHAs) for LLNL facilities with significant hazardous materials, applying rigorous hazards analysis methodologies.
